Maintaining and building muscle is important for several reasons. The top reasons being:
- Muscles burns fat
- More muscle mass increases your metabolism
- Muscles can improve your overall appearance.
Causes of Muscle Loss
We begin to experience muscle loss after puberty. Therefore, if you don’t continue to build and maintain muscle, the more you will lose. Age is also a factor in muscle loss. As we get older we lose muscle. If you think performing constant cardio will help maintain muscle — think again. Steady state cardio can actually lead to muscle loss.
How to Build and Maintain Muscle
- Start weight training
- Use interval training to prevent muscle loss
- Use body weight exercises
- Eat healthier
I don’t feel it is ever too late to begin building muscle. Since we begin to lose muscle mass as we age, lifting weights can benefit us at any age from teens to senior citizens. It also doesn’t require a bunch of weight machines either. Dumbbells and a bench can be enough for most people to get the job done as long as they’re consistent.
